Housenetwork Ltd are pleased to offer this 4 bedrooms semi-detached house for sale. The property briefly comprises of dining room, play room, sitting room, kitchen, 4 bedrooms and bathroom. The property covers approximately 1507sqft.

This is a great opportunity to purchase this beautiful 4 bedroom semi-detached period property with stunning views over Pendle Hill. Spacious and finished to a high standard, the property sits in grounds with gardens to the front, side and rear as well as an adjoining kitchen garden. Internally, with many original features including professionally restored and encapsulated stained glass windows, the property is brimming with character, space and light. Upstairs there are four well proportioned bedrooms, the Master benefiting from far reaching views over the countryside towards Pendle Hill.

The house is ideally situated on a quiet street and is not overlooked, yet is minutes away from the M65. To the front the views are truly stunning. The gardens have been landscaped to be low maintenance and child friendly with two lawns, sophisticated decking and large patio areas in Indian stone. A summer house on the front patio is the perfect retreat to take in the evening sunset.

The property is complete with kitchen garden which includes a 25ft poly-tunnel, ideal for those wanting to 'grow your own'. To the rear of the property there is ample on-road parking on the quiet street and an adjoining drive with off-road parking for 2 cars.

The location is perfect for a family with numerous schools in the local area including, Pendle Primary Academy, Holy Trinity Roman Catholic Primary School, Brierfield and St John Southworth Roman Catholic Primary School. Access is also ideal with the M65 a short distance away.
